Summary: | 4, litchdon street, barnstaple (now demolished). In 1959 the house was derelict and in plan consisted of a range lying parallel to the street with a short wing projecting from one end at the back. Wing had 1 1/2 bays of xv century arch-braced roof and in upper room some xvii plasterwork. The main range had plaster ceiling of c 1750 on ground floor, also stairs of same period. Xviii ceiling upstairs also. First floor fireplace had ornamental plasterwork fireplace, c 1620.(description given).(everett). |
